Asus to Unveil Gaming Laptops with Nvidia Blackwell GPUs at CES 2025

A recent leak has revealed exciting details about Asus’ upcoming gaming laptops equipped with Nvidia’s next-gen Blackwell mobile GPUs, sparking anticipation in the tech community. These leaks, surfacing from online retailers and amplified by prominent tech platform VideoCardz, suggest that major announcements are expected at CES 2025. The new lineup could significantly elevate the gaming hardware landscape with the introduction of laptops featuring the highly anticipated RTX 5090, 5080, and 5070 Ti models, along with powerful Intel Arrow Lake processors and substantial DDR5 RAM.

Impressive Specifications and Models

Asus ROG Strix G835 Features

One of the standout models from the leaks is the Asus ROG Strix G835, which is set to house an RTX 5090 GPU paired with 16GB of VRAM. This gaming powerhouse will be driven by the Intel Core Ultra 9 275HX processor, a formidable combination promising top-tier gaming performance. The 18-inch display with a resolution of 2048 x 1536 will undoubtedly provide an immersive visual experience, catering to high-end gamers seeking both performance and visual fidelity. Asus ROG Zephyrus GU605 Variants

Another exciting revelation from the leaks is the Asus ROG Zephyrus GU605, which offers configurations that include the RTX 5090, 5080, and 5070 Ti GPUs. This variety allows gamers to choose a model that best fits their performance needs and budget. Paired with the Intel Core Ultra 9 285H CPU, these variants promise robust processing power, making the Zephyrus GU605 a versatile option for both hardcore gamers and professional users. The 16-inch screen size strikes a balance between portability and a spacious display, appealing to a wide array of users.
